You Only Live Twice was made on location in the Red Cliffs National Conservation Area fifteen miles north of St. George, Utah during the St George Plein Air Art Festival in April 2026. It was exhibited as part of this exhibition with 75 artists from 16 states and three countries. Lindsey’s Ash Down Gorge, scratchboard, 2″ x 3″, took first place in the mini category.
The curvilinear canyon walls that narrow form a bilateral symmetrical landscape with an expanse of clouds above, a reflected sky below in a pool of snowmelt, and a small waterfall bifurcating the two heavens. Thus, “You Only Live Twice” was the only title that seemed truly fitting for this composition.
